EVO Nano+ keeps losing connection randomly, not sure whats going on

  • Members

so this has been happening for a few weeks now and i cant figure out if its the drone, the controller, or just where im flying. basically im out, everything is fine, and then the video feed just drops for like 5-10 seconds and comes back. the drone doesnt return to home or anything it just kind of... hangs there and reconnects. its happened maybe 6 or 7 times now in different locations so im not sure its an interference thing.

checked the firmware and its up to date. tried reinstalling the app too. i fly mostly in open suburban areas nothing crazy. the range has never actually been a problem its usually happening when im like 200 feet away which feels like it shouldnt be an issue at all.

anybody dealt with this? im wondering if somthing is up with the controller itself because it feels like the signal strength display doesnt always match what im actually experiencing.

had something similar on my Nano+ a while back and it turned out my phone was the culprit ? it kept trying to switch between wifi networks mid-flight which was messing with the connection. if youre using your phone as part of the setup make sure wifi is completely off and only using the controller's own link. sounds obvious but it got me for a while.

also worth checking if theres anything running in the background on your phone eating up resources, the app doesnt always play nice when the phones doing other stuff at the same time.

the signal strength indicator on those is kind of useless in my experience, doesnt really reflect whats actually happening. could also be a loose antenna connection inside the controller but thats harder to diagnose without opening it up. if its still under warranty id honestly just contact Autel support, they're actually pretty decent compared to some others ive dealt with, at least they respond.
